• Introduction <br />Mine water inflow results were consistent with the predictions presented in the mining permit <br />application. No apparent measurable mine water inflow was detected during the 2001 <br />underground inspection of the Bowie No. 2 Mine on November 24, 2001. <br />Discharged Water <br />The mine has not dischazged any inflow water from the underground workings nor do the mine <br />portals contribute drainage to the permitted drainage system of the facilities area. <br />Sumps <br />Eight underground sumps were located during this inspection. Mine officials reported that these <br />sumps and their contents were the results of machinery washing and recovered water from belt <br />conveyors where water is applied to allay respirable dust at coal transfer points. <br />These belt line and wash bay sumps held insignificant water and were not tested. <br />Other Water Sources <br />A visual inspection of the lower entry of both the Main North Entries and gate entries of both the <br />D4, DS and D6 longwall panels produced no evidence of any other water sources or storage <br />areas. No significant pooling of water along the travelways or beltlines was found. <br />Consumptive Use <br />• The Bowie No. 2 Mine now extracts dust suppression and sanitary water from the Deer Trail <br />Ditch via the new pump station located on the Deer Trail ditch as shown on Map15-1 of the <br />permit application. During the first months of operation and while the pump station and water <br />line was constructed, water was pumped from this ditch into a water truck, hauled to the portal <br />area and stored in a temporary tank for fire protection and underground dust suppression. <br />Additional water from this source was hauled via the water truck for dust abatement on the mine <br />access roads. <br />The pump station is now fully operable and metered. This meter records the consumptive use of <br />water from the Deer Trail Ditch. During the 2001 calendar year, the Bowie No. 2 Mine <br />consumed 197.11 AC-FT of water in order to produce 5,434,000 tons of coal. Pond evaporation <br />is estimated at 2.0 AC-FT per yeaz. The addition of the estimated pond evaporation to the mine <br />consumption produces a consumptive use of 199.1 I AC-FT of water for the 2001 yeaz and is les< <br />than the estimated 234.6 AC-FT indicated in the permit application. This usage indicates that <br />water for dust suppression and fire prevention at the Bowie No. 2 Mine is currently averaging <br />approximately 36.8 AC-FT per million tons of coal. <br />Conclusions <br />It is reasonable to assume that during the 2001 Mine Water Inflow study season, less than 10 <br />gallons per minute are flowing into the mine workings of the Bowie No. 2 Mine, that <br />approximately 120 gallons of water per minute is introduced from the Deer Trail Ditch and that <br />any sudden increase in mine inflow values could be reasonable incorporated into the dust <br />suppression process, precluding the necessity for any mine discharges. <br />
